What material matters most when choosing a 2 tier tray and why?
Material affects durability, care needs, and where you can use the tray. Metal mesh trays are sturdy and great for documents and everyday office use, as seen in the 2 Tier Metal Mesh Desktop Document File Sliding Tray Organiser. Ceramic and porcelain options are ideal for display or jewelry-style contexts, like a 2 Tier Cake Stand. Plastics offer lightweight, moisture-resistant performance for kitchen or craft setups, such as modular dish racks in plastic finishes. Match the material to your items and cleaning routine to keep the tray looking good longer.

How should I clean and maintain a 2 tier tray and what compatibility should I check?
Keep it clean by following material-specific care: wipe metal surfaces, hand-wash ceramic pieces, and avoid harsh cleaners on plastics. Check that the tray fits your space and supports the items you plan to put on it, and look for compatibility with any existing organizers or shelving. If the tray includes draining or collapsible features, follow the manufacturer's folding and draining guidelines to prevent damage. Use non-slip pads to prevent sliding on smooth surfaces.
